Dynamic malware analysis is a key part of any threat investigation. It involves executing a sample of a malicious program in the isolated environment of a malware sandbox to monitor its behavior and gather actionable indicators. Effective analysis must be fast, in-depth, and precise. These five tools will help you achieve it with ease. 1. Interactivity Having the ability to interact with the malware and the system in real-time is a great advantage when it comes to dynamic analysis. This way, you can not only observe its execution but also see how it responds to your inputs and triggers specific behaviors.  Plus, it saves time by allowing you to download samples hosted on file-sharing websites or open those packed inside an archive, which is a common way to deliver payloads to victims. What is a malware analysis lab? In essence, a malware analysis lab provides a safe, isolated space for examining malware. The setup can range from a straightforward virtual machine using VirtualBox to a more intricate network of interconnected machines and actual networking hardware. But in this article, we'll look at building a lab tailored for static analysis, so what we will need is a secure environment where we can run disassemblers, edit binary files and debug. NetworkMiner 1.1 -  Network Forensic Analysis Tool (NFAT) Released  NetworkMiner is a Network Forensic Analysis Tool (NFAT) for Windows. NetworkMiner can be used as a passive network sniffer/packet capturing tool in order to detect operating systems, sessions, hostnames, open ports etc. without putting any traffic on the network. NetworkMiner can also parse PCAP files for off-line analysis and to regenerate/reassemble transmitted files and certificates from PCAP files.NetworkMiner collects data (such as forensic evidence) about hosts on the network rather than to collect data regarding the traffic on the network. The main user interface view is host centric (information grouped per host) rather than packet centric (information showed as a list of packets/frames). Unknown malware presents a significant cybersecurity threat and can cause serious damage to organizations and individuals alike. When left undetected, malicious code can gain access to confidential information, corrupt data, and allow attackers to gain control of systems. Find out how to avoid these circumstances and detect unknown malicious behavior efficiently.  Challenges of new threats' detection While known malware families are more predictable and can be detected more easily, unknown threats can take on a variety of forms, causing a bunch of challenges for their detection: Malware developers use polymorphism, which enables them to modify the malicious code to generate unique variants of the same malware.  There is malware that is still not identified and doesn't have any rulesets for detection. What is Wireshark? Wireshark is the world's most popular network protocol analyzer. It is used for troubleshooting, analysis, development and education. What's New Bug Fixes The following vulnerabilities have been fixed. See the security advisory for details and a workaround. o Huzaifa Sidhpurwala of the Red Hat Security Response Team discovered that Wireshark could free an uninitialized pointer while reading a malformed pcap-ng file. (Bug 5652) Versions affected: 1.2.0 to 1.2.14 and 1.4.0 to 1.4.3. CVE-2011-0538 o Huzaifa Sidhpurwala of the Red Hat Security Response Team discovered that a large packet length in a pcap-ng file could crash Wireshark. (Bug 5661) Versions affected: 1.2.0 to 1.2.14 and 1.4.0 to 1.4.3. o Wireshark could overflow a buffer while reading a Nokia DCT3 trace file. " Wireshark is the world's most popular network protocol analyzer. It is used for troubleshooting, analysis, development, and education ." This update fixes many vulnerabilities such as the one with MAC-LTE dissector and the ENTTEC dissector. The following protocols have been updated – AMQP, ASN.1 BER, ASN.1 PER, CFM, CIGI, DHCPv6, Diameter, ENTTEC, GSM A GM, IEEE 802.11, InfiniBand, LTE-PDCP, LTP, MAC-LTE, MP2T, RADIUS, SAMR, SCCP, SIP, SNMP, TCP, TLS, TN3270, UNISTIM and WPS. You can now read captures via the Endace ERF, Microsoft Network Monitor and VMS TCPtrace file formats. For a complete list of changes, please refer to the 1.4.3 release notes. Cybersecurity researchers are calling attention to a malware campaign that's targeting security flaws in TBK digital video recorders (DVRs) and Four-Faith routers to rope the devices into a new botnet called RondoDox . The vulnerabilities in question include CVE-2024-3721 , a medium-severity command injection vulnerability affecting TBK DVR-4104 and DVR-4216 DVRs, and CVE-2024-12856 , an operating system (OS) command injection bug affecting Four-Faith router models F3x24 and F3x36. Many of these devices are installed in critical environments like retail stores, warehouses, and small offices, where they often go unmonitored for years. That makes them ideal targets—easy to exploit, hard to detect, and usually exposed directly to the internet through outdated firmware or misconfigured ports.
